Nie jestem do końca pewien, o co prosisz, ale jeśli chcesz, aby określona funkcja była uruchamiana po zaznaczeniu opcji pola wyboru, dlaczego nie użyć zdarzenia onchange w polu wyboru?
<select id="mySelect" onchange="runFunction(document.getElementById('mySelect').value);">
<option value="myValue"></option>
<option value="moreValues"></option>
<option value="anotherValue"></option>
</select>
wtedy funkcja może robić różne rzeczy w zależności od wartości, które zostały przekazane, prostym przykładem będzie
function runFunction(option){
if(option === "myValue"){
Do something
}
}